Just of the mounts and how you made them
Oh i didnt make then. http://www.ebay.com/itm/ProComm-JBC..._Radio_Comm_Device_Mounts&hash=item2ea2b5ac01
This is the ebay listing i used. i just went and bought two of these. doesnt come with screw though. so i just used some screws, popped the hood and put them where i thought they looked good. It was very hard to do alone though. it was a challange to hold the bracket, hold the screw/ screw gun upside and have enough pressure to punch through the metal. And then i just marked the other side so i could get even. each bracket is held with 2 screws.
